LICENSING ACT 2003

Notice Of Application For A Premises Licence

Notice is given that Luigi Fersini has applied to London Borough of Tower Hamlets Licensing Authority for a Premises Licence under the Licensing Act 2003. Premises details Unit 4003, 4 Schwartz Wharf, London, E9 5AA. The Licensable Activities are as follows: The Sale Of Alcohol By Retail, For Consumption Both On And Off The Premises: Monday To Thursday 10:00 - 00:00, Friday And Saturday 10:00 - 02:00, And Sunday 10:00 - 23:00. The Provision Of Regulated Entertainment (Live & Recorded Music Indoors): Monday To Thursday 10:00 - 00:00, Friday And Saturday 10:00 - 02:00, And Sunday 10:00 - 23:00. The Provision Of Late-Night Refreshment Both On And Off The Premises: Monday To Thursday 10:00 - 00:00, Friday And Saturday 10:00 - 02:00 and Sunday 10:00 - 22:00.

Anyone who wishes to make representations regarding this application must give notice in writing to: The Licensing Section, London Borough of Tower Hamlets, Tower Hamlets Town Hall, 160 Whitechapel Road, London, E1 1BJ, or email: licensing@towerhamlets.gov.uk. Website: www.towerhamlets.gov.uk. Tel: 020 7364 5008. Representations must be received no later than 16/07/2026. The Application Record and Register may be viewed between 10:00am and 4:00pm Monday to Friday during normal office hours at the above address. It is an offence under Section 158 of the Licensing Act 2003, knowingly or recklessly to make a false statement in connection with an application and the maximum fine for which a person is liable on summary conviction for the offence is up to level 5 on the standard scale (unlimited fine).
